The best way of understanding the physics is to solve physics problems. This is the third book from the series Baby Steps In Physics. A student is wondering," How do I start? From where do I start? What formula should I use? " As with the previous books in the series, the book tries to answer these questions.The book features problems and solutions worked out in detail. The problems are arranged by increasing level of difficulty that allows the student to use this book independently. Indeed, this book is only a third step towards understanding how to solve physics problems. However, the book encourages personal confidence in problem-solving and develops the student's knowledge of physics.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
